The Institute of Public Health has launched a new factsheet series providing evidence relating to COVID-19 and key public health topics. The first factsheet provides a summary of evidence relating to COVID-19 and tobacco. Each factsheet is a ‘snapshot’ based on a review of available evidence at the time of writing. 

The factsheets will be routinely reviewed and periodically updated. The Institute is currently assisting the Departments of Health, North and South, with evidence review and policy development on the impact of COVID-19 and related Public Health and Social Measures (PHSM) on population health.
